What makes someone attractive?
Is it confidence? Physical chemistry? Shared values? Emotional intelligence?
In this episode of Imperfectly Honest, Elizabeth is joined by her friend and Imperfectly Honest partner in crime, Kayla Gorski, to explore the psychology of attraction, modern dating, relationship compatibility, and the surprising qualities that create lasting connection. From confidence and curiosity to self-awareness and emotional intelligence, they unpack what women really find attractive—and how those preferences evolve over time.
Drawing from their own dating experiences, conversations about dating after divorce, and reflections on healthy relationships, Elizabeth and Kayla discuss why attraction is often about far more than physical appearance.
